Tanaka Precious Metals Commence Sales of Highly Electrically Conductive Silver Alloy Bonding Wire on January 15
Electrical conductivity improved by approx. 30%, providing the same performance as high-purity gold bonding wire

TOKYO, Jan 14, 2014 - (ACN Newswire) - Tanaka Holdings Co., Ltd. (a company of Tanaka Precious Metals) today announced that Tanaka Denshi Kogyo K.K. of Tanaka Precious Metals, which boasts the world's leading share in bonding wire (wiring material) manufacturing, has developed "SEC" silver alloy bonding wire (referred to as "SEC" below) with electrical conductivity improved by approximately 30% compared to the existing product, and will commence sales on January 15.

SEC has electrical resistivity of 2.6 micro-ohm centimeters, and electrical conductivity has improved by approximately 30% compared to the existing product (Tanaka's "SEB"). As a result, it provides electrical resistivity comparable to that of the electrical resistance (approximately 2.3 micro-ohm centimeters) of bonding wire made of 99.99% purity gold (referred to as 4N-Au wire below). Furthermore, the FAB (Free Air Ball: the ball shape formed by the melted tip of the bonding wire) softness has also been improved to the same level as 4N-Au, providing high bondability that meets high performance requirements without damaging aluminum electrodes.

Costs Can be Reduced by Approximately 80% with the Same Performance as 4N-Au Wire

When replacing 4N-Au wire with silver alloy bonding wire, it is possible to reduce precious metal bullion costs by approximately 80%(*1), but increased electrical resistivity (lower electrical conductivity) was an issue. SEC optimizes the alloy composition that caused the increased electrical resistivity, providing the same performance as 4N-Au wire by improving processing methods. Customers can use SEC in all areas where 4N-Au wire is used such as IC and LSI wiring material. The features of SEC are as follows.

-- Electrical conductivity: Has been improved by approximately 30%, providing the same level of electrical conductivity as 4N-Au wire.
-- Bondability: SEC has excellent bondability due to FAB softness improvement comparable to 4N-Au wire.
-- Cost: Compared to the precious metal bullion cost of 4N-Au wire, the precious metal bullion cost of SEC is approximately 80% lower.
-- Corrosion resistance: SEC has the same level of high reliability as the existing product.
-- Productivity: SEC allows for sufficient adhesion under almost the same usage conditions as 4N-Au wire.
-- SEC can be attached using inexpensive and safe nitrogen gas by partially modifying the equipment for gold bonding wire.

(*1) When the wire diameter is 25 micrometers (micro is 1/1,000,000).
